▌ Editor's read YMCA Camp Sequoia Lake's website loads successfully and presents as a legitimate camp. It is accredited by the American Camp Association (ACA) with accreditation expiring in 2024, confirming adherence to industry standards. The camp has a California state license number 1000000000. The camp has been operating since 1913, indicating a long-standing presence in youth development. The owner type is clearly nonprofit, as it is a YMCA camp. The website explicitly states that all staff undergo background checks. The program type is overnight, offering traditional summer camp activities. The camp has a strong online presence with an Instagram handle @ymcacampsequoialake and a Facebook handle YMCACampSequoiaLake. Google reviews show a rating of 4.8 stars based on 100+ reviews, with many praising the beautiful location, engaging activities, and caring staff.
